In most Indian households, women are the custodians of intangible heritage. They are the ones who know the precise recipe for the pongal during harvest festivals, the rhythm of the karva chauth moon-sighting prayer, and the specific lullabies passed down through seven generations. This role provides immense cultural power and respect, but historically came at the cost of public autonomy.

Education has been the primary tool for empowerment in India. Millions of young women are outperforming their male counterparts in school board examinations and enrolling in higher education at record rates. India boasts one of the highest percentages of female graduates in STEM (Science, Technology, Engineering, and Mathematics) fields globally.
